WebJul 27, 2024 · When the dial is set at 1 liter, 24 percent oxygen is being delivered. For each increase in the number on the flow meter dial, the amount of oxygen delivered increases by 4 percent. If the flow meter is set at 2 liters, the oxygen delivered goes up to 28 percent. The highest level of liters allowed is 6 and delivers 44 percent oxygen.

Prebypass whole-body oxygen consumption measured at … fisher new york postWebApr 29, 2024 · How much oxygen does a person need? A human breathes about 9.5 tonnes of air in a year, but oxygen only makes up about 23 percent of that air (by mass), and we only extract a little over a third of the oxygen from each breath. That works out to a total of about 740kg of oxygen per year. Which is, very roughly, seven or eight trees’ worth. So ... can a job change your schedule without notice
